CVE ID :CVE-2026-81705
Published : Aug. 27, 2026, 5:21 p.m. | 48 minutes ago
Description :openssl-encrypt before 1.4.9 fails to redact the file password in its --debug argv dump when the password is supplied via bundled short-option spellings (e.g. -apHunter2) or abbreviated long-option spellings (e.g. --passw). The sanitizer only recognized exact option names, --option=value forms, and tokens starting with -p, so these spellings bypass the redaction chokepoint and the cleartext password is written to stderr. Anyone with access to that output (terminal scrollback, merged 2>&1 output, CI job logs, or the GUI's persistent debug log) can recover the password.
Severity: 8.7 | HIGH
